The Time-Traveling Tangle: A Futuristic Fiasco
In the bustling metropolis of Neo-London, amidst the towering skyscrapers and flying cars, two friends, Max and Ellie, found themselves in the middle of a technological marvel they could never have imagined—a time-traveling device. The device was a sleek, metallic orb that seemed to hum with ancient energy. It had been left abandoned in an old, dusty storage unit, forgotten by time.
Max, an engineer with a knack for fixing anything that could possibly break, had always been fascinated by the concept of time-travel. Ellie, an artist, found beauty in the unknown and was often drawn to the most peculiar gadgets. It was only natural that they had become close friends, sharing a passion for the extraordinary.
One rainy afternoon, while rummaging through the storage unit, they stumbled upon the orb. Max, with a mixture of excitement and trepidation, decided to plug it into the nearest power outlet. The room was immediately filled with a blinding light, and the two friends found themselves being pulled into the swirling vortex of the device.
When the light faded, they found themselves in a strange, unfamiliar landscape. Max checked his watch, but it was no longer working. "This is crazy," Ellie whispered, her voice tinged with awe. The sky was a surreal shade of purple, and the buildings around them seemed to float in mid-air, defying gravity.
They wandered through the streets, trying to make sense of their surroundings. Suddenly, a futuristic police car screeched to a halt in front of them. "What do you two think you're doing?" barked the officer, his voice filled with suspicion.
"We don't know where we are," Max replied, trying to keep his composure. "We were just exploring."
The officer scrutinized them for a moment before shrugging. "Follow me," he said, getting back into his car. They followed him through a series of tunnels, until they arrived at a futuristic police station.
The officer led them to an interrogation room. "Your time here is limited," he said, sitting down across from them. "We need to know why you're here. Time-travelers are rare, and we need to ensure that you don't disrupt the timeline."
Max and Ellie exchanged a nervous glance. "We didn't come here to disrupt anything," Max said. "We just wanted to explore."
The officer's expression softened slightly. "Exploring is good, but you have to follow the rules. Time-travel is dangerous. One wrong move, and the consequences could be catastrophic."
As they left the police station, they realized they were being watched. They couldn't go back to their own time, and they had no idea how to get back. Desperation set in, and they began to wander the streets of this unknown world, searching for answers.
Their adventure took them through different eras, from the Stone Age to the distant future. They encountered dinosaurs, robots, and even time-traveling pirates. Each era brought its own set of challenges and moral dilemmas. Max and Ellie had to learn quickly how to navigate the complexities of these worlds, often finding themselves in situations that tested their courage and loyalty.
In one instance, they were caught in the middle of a political uprising. Max's engineering skills were put to the test as he had to repair a broken communication device that was crucial for the revolutionaries to communicate with their allies. Ellie's artistic talent allowed her to create propaganda posters that would inspire the masses to rise up against their oppressive regime.
As they journeyed through time, they discovered that the time-traveling device was powered by emotions. The more passionate they became about the causes they believed in, the stronger the device's power. This realization led them to form a deep bond, as they realized that their combined emotions could change the course of history.
One day, while exploring a futuristic city, they stumbled upon a time-traveling archive. Inside, they found records of their own time, showing how their actions had ripple effects that reached far beyond their immediate circle. They saw that their adventures in time had not only impacted their own lives but also the lives of countless others.
As they delved deeper into the archive, they discovered a message from their future selves. It was a warning: "Be careful what you wish for, for it may come true." The message was a stark reminder that the power of time-travel came with great responsibility.
The time-traveling orb began to flicker, and they knew it was time to return. With a heavy heart, they activated the device one last time. The blinding light enveloped them, and they were pulled back to their own time.
When they opened their eyes, they found themselves back in the storage unit. Max and Ellie exchanged a look of relief, knowing that they had made it back safe. They had faced countless challenges, grown closer together, and learned invaluable lessons about the impact of their actions.
From that day forward, they were not just friends; they were partners in destiny. They continued to explore the world, using their unique abilities to make a difference. And every time they thought about the time-traveling orb, they would smile, knowing that they had a piece of the past, present, and future in their hands.
The Time-Traveling Tangle: A Futuristic Fiasco is a story about the power of friendship, the responsibility of time-travelers, and the incredible possibilities that come with exploring the unknown.
